| Canonical Smiles | C1C2=CNC(=C2CO1)C(=O)O |
|---|---|
| IUPAC Name | 3,5-dihydro-1H-furo[3,4-c]pyrrole-4-carboxylic acid |
| InChIKey | SJRCMPLGSSJASF-UHFFFAOYSA-N |
| INCHI | 1S/C7H7NO3/c9-7(10)6-5-3-11-2-4(5)1-8-6/h1,8H,2-3H2,(H,9,10) |
| Isomeric SMILES | C1C2=CNC(=C2CO1)C(=O)O |
| PubChem CID | 45082057 |
| Molecular Weight | 153.14 |

| Description | This compound belongs to the class of organic compounds known as furopyrroles. These are organic polycyclic compounds containing a furan ring fused to a pyrrole ring. Furan is a five-membered aromatic ring with four carbon atoms and one oxygen atom. Pyrrole is 5-membered ring consisting of four carbon atoms and one nitrogen atom. |
